#0b1695 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0b1695 is composed of 4.3% red, 8.6%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.6% cyan, 85.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 235.2 degrees, a saturation of 86.3% and a lightness of 31.4%. #0b1695 color hex could be obtained by blending #162cff with #00002b.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

Shades and Tints of #0b1695
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000003 is the darkest color, while #f0f1fe is the lightest one.
